UTA/UDOT present Frontrunner 2X plan to double peak service in corridor
UTA and UDOT officials updated the Davis County Commission on the Frontrunner 2X strategic double-tracking project, saying it will expand parts of the 83-mile corridor to allow trains to run twice as often. "That's the Frontrunner 2X project," presenter Frank Parker told commissioners, describing how adding targeted double-track sections will reduce peak headways from 30 minutes to 15 minutes and off‑peak headways from 60 to 30 minutes.

Project staff listed concrete elements of the plan: 11 double-track sections in the corridor, one planned new station near Bluffdale, at least one track realignment near Warm Springs, acquisition of 10 new train sets, and a new maintenance facility sited on property near the Davis and Salt Lake county line to support the expanded fleet. Presenter (identified in the meeting materials) said design work is progressing, procurement of the trains is underway, environmental studies are complete, and construction will begin next year with an anticipated commissioning and full 15‑minute peak service by 2030.

Commissioners and staff asked about local impacts in Davis County. Project staff pointed to specific sections north of Clearfield and Woods Cross where double-tracking will occur and warned of temporary road impacts and irrigation work that could require closures. The team said early work is being scheduled this winter to coordinate with related I‑15 construction and to avoid overlapping closures. Project staff also committed to community outreach and notifications for residents near tracks and announced a project website and contact information for questions.
